Understanding Tinnitus Causes
Wiki Article
The origins of tinnitus, that persistent perception of buzzing or other noises in the ears, are incredibly varied. While a single cause often is difficult to pinpoint, numerous potential factors have been recognized. Exposure to high-volume noise, like from concerts, is a major culprit, frequently resulting in noise-induced hearing damage which then precipitates tinnitus. Beyond that, certain medical ailments, such as increased blood pressure, sugar diabetes, and thyroid disorders, can also be involved. Furthermore, drugs, particularly certain pharmaceutical preparations and salicylic acid, have been associated with the beginning of tinnitus. Finally, damage to the cranium or aural cavity can occasionally initiate this unwanted noise.

Inner Ear Problems: A Common Cause of Tinnitus
Tinnitus, that persistent ringing in the ears, can be incredibly distressing. While numerous reasons contribute to its development, problems within the inner structures are frequently the leading culprit. This delicate region, responsible for both hearing and balance, houses the cochlea and vestibular system. Damage or dysfunction within these components – perhaps due to noise-induced injury, Meniere's disease, or even a build-up of cerumen – can disrupt normal auditory processing. This disruption, in turn, may lead the brain to perceive a phantom tone even in the absence of an external stimulus. Therefore, a thorough evaluation by an audiologist or ENT specialist is crucial for determining the underlying cause and exploring appropriate management options.

Ototoxic Drugs: How They Can Cause TinnitusDrug-Induced Hearing Loss: Understanding TinnitusMedications and Tinnitus: A Closer Look
Certain pharmaceuticals can, unfortunately, damage the delicate structures of the inner auditory system, leading to a condition known as ototoxicity. This damage can manifest in various ways, one of the most common and distressing being ringing in the ears. Tinnitus is often described as a ringing sound, but it can also feel like clicking, hissing, or roaring. The process by which these drugs that damage hearing induce tinnitus isn't always fully understood, but it's believed that they can disrupt the normal functioning of the hair cells in the cochlea, or affect the auditory nerve. Common culprits include some medications fighting infection, certain medications for cancer, and even some medications for fluid retention. The risk of developing tinnitus varies depending on factors like dosage, duration of treatment, and individual susceptibility. Early detection and careful monitoring by a healthcare professional are crucial for managing and potentially mitigating these effects.
Exploring Noise-Induced Hearing Loss and Resulting Tinnitus
Exposure to intense noise, whether from construction machinery, music, or even recreational audio devices, can inflict significant damage to the central ear. This damage frequently manifests as noise-induced hearing loss (NIHL), a condition characterized by a steadily decline in hearing ability. Often, this hearing loss is accompanied or followed by tinnitus, a ongoing ringing, buzzing, or clicking sound in the ears, even in the absence of external noise. The delicate hair cells within the cochlea, responsible for converting sound vibrations into electrical signals, are particularly vulnerable. Frequent exposure to noise can cause these cells to become permanently damaged, resulting in a combination of hearing loss and the distress of tinnitus. While NIHL is often preventable through sound protection and noise reduction measures, existing damage is generally irreversible, making early intervention and protective strategies crucial for preserving auditory health and minimizing the impact of tinnitus. Furthermore, individuals with NIHL may experience difficulty understanding speech, leading to social isolation and impacting their quality of life.

Acoustic Neuroma & Tinnitus: A Rare Cause
While ear noise is frequently associated with more common conditions like noise exposure or ear infections, in a limited number of cases, it can be a symptom of a less frequent, but serious, medical condition: an acoustic neuroma. These benign tumors, also known as vestibular schwannomas, develop on the vestibular nerve, which connects the inner ear to the brain. The presence of tinnitus alongside other symptoms, such as hearing loss, balance difficulties, or numbness in the face, should prompt a thorough medical assessment. It's crucial to remember that experiencing tinnitus doesn’t automatically indicate an acoustic tumor; however, recognizing it as a possible, albeit rare, indication is necessary for timely diagnosis and appropriate management.

Idiopathic Tinnitus: When the Cause Remains Unknown
For many individuals experiencing tinnitus, the origin of their perception remains elusive. This is known as idiopathic ringing in the ears, a frustrating condition where a thorough examination fails to reveal an underlying medical cause. Unlike ear noise triggered by factors like earwax blockage, hearing loss, or medication, idiopathic perception presents a diagnostic puzzle. The absence of a readily identifiable trigger doesn’t diminish the impact on the individual's well-being; it simply complicates the management process. While exhaustive investigations – including audiological assessments and imaging – are crucial to rule out other conditions, treatment often focuses on management techniques and addressing the associated distress rather than targeting a specific underlying pathology. Researchers continue to explore potential contributing factors, believing that a combination of physiological, psychological, and neurological elements may play a role in this challenging form of ear discomfort.
